Under moderate supervision, coordinate work within or between departments of the plant to support production.

 

The Business Analyst Planner is responsible to provide support the European planning team for their routine and preparatory tasks. This role is vital for maintaining data accuracy, communicating with stakeholders, and supporting the overall efficiency of planning processes to ensure effective and timely execution of planning activities.

MAJOR J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Assist with Unit of Measure (UOM) changes, including inventory and consumption setting adjustments.
  • Perform updates to material master data for routine changes (MOQ, rounding value).
  • Support product discontinuation activities, including centralizing and selling out remaining stock.
  • Manage batch and general transfer requests across the Europe distribution network.
  • Respond to general sales order inquiries and escalate issues where necessary.
  • Process and analyze reservation contract for customers.
  • Process and analyze customer return requests.
  • Support CVC consistency checks and alignment in APO (Advanced Planning & Optimization).
  • Support with correct set up of our supply chain network flow, taking into account regulatory, temperature,… specifics of the materials
  • Assist in warehouse relocation activities by updating supply chain network settings and monitoring stock movement.
  • Conduct monthly checks on stock discrepancies (e.g., incorrect locations), overstocked locations and perform corrective actions.
  • Release blocked sales orders (P2 blocks) by liaising with Customer Service teams.
  • Handle ad hoc reporting and data preparation (e.g., SRF reporting, consumption copies).
  • Support with allocation and responding to mails received at the central planning mailbox
QUALIFICATIONS (Education/Training, Experience and Certifications):
  • Bachelor degree in Supply Chain Management, Business, Management or other applicable discipline preferred.
  • 1-3 years supply chain experience.
  • APICS/CPIM certification desirable.
  • Experience with ERP systems (especially SAP), experience with forecasting tools (e.g., APO) is strongly desired.
  • Strong analytical mindset; comfortable working with large data sets.
  • Proactive and curious; willing to ask questions and seek clarification.
  • Capable of working independently and remotely, following established procedures.
  • Detail-oriented, and highly organized.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Excel and familiar with PowerBI and QlikView for reporting.
